Why Vedic Mathematics Benefits Students at School Level
Learning Vedic Mathematics at the school level can significantly enhance students' mental calculation abilities, improve problem-solving skills, and promote a deeper understanding of mathematical concepts through efficient and unconventional techniques. Vedic Mathematics, a system of mathematics that originated in India, offers a plethora of benefits that are highly advantageous for students in schools. This article will explore why Vedic Mathematics is indispensable for students, focusing on enhancing their mathematical skills and confidence.
Why Vedic Mathematics is Essential for Students
1. Simplifying Mathematics: Vedic Mathematics presents mathematics as straightforward, easy, and faster. It transforms the subject from a source of stress and frustration into a delightful and accessible area of study. This shift in perspective can have a profound impact on students' attitudes towards mathematics.

3. Speed and Accuracy: Vedic Mathematics also promotes speed and accuracy in calculations. The use of one-line methods and simple shortcuts can significantly reduce the time it takes to solve problems. This not only aligns with the fast-paced environment of today's classrooms but also enhances students' problem-solving skills.
Additional Benefits of Studying Vedic Mathematics
1. Intuitive Understanding: Vedic Mathematics encourages students to develop their intuition for mathematics by looking for patterns and using their understanding of numbers to solve problems. This can help students to develop a stronger connection with mathematical concepts and become more confident in their ability to solve problems.
2. Unique Perspective: Vedic Mathematics offers a unique perspective on mathematics, enabling students to see problems in a new light. This can make mathematics more interesting and engaging, fostering a love for the subject that can last a lifetime.
3. Creative Problem-Solving: Vedic Mathematics teaches students to think outside the box and come up with innovative solutions to problems. This can be particularly beneficial in academic and professional settings, where creative and innovative thinking is highly valued.
